Over 2 kg gold seized from woman at Chennai airport

Chennai, Feb 1 (SocialNews.XYZ) The CISF personnel on Saturday seized over 2 kg gold valued around Rs 1 crore from a woman at Chennai international airport, officials said.

A senior CISF officer said Vijaykumari, who exhibited "suspicious behaviour", was intercepted and taken to a frisking booth where she was checked by women CISF personnel.

The woman, a housekeeping staff of Travel Food Services, Chennai, was stopped when she was walking out of the new international terminal building.

Around 2.4 kg (a total of 24 pieces of gold bars) wrapped in black adhesive and tied around her waist in a bandolier was found.

During questioning, the woman said she got the gold bars from a woman passenger in the washroom.

The custom department officials were informed and the gold bars handed over to them.
